#e25288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e25288 is composed of 88.6% red, 32.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.7%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#e25288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#c50011.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e25288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e25288 has RGB values of R:226, G:82,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.4,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14832264.

Shades and Tints of #e25288
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0206 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e25288
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9899 is the less saturated color, while #f93b82 is the most saturated one.
